我希望能够通过单击链接来取消选择具有多个选择启用和选项组的选择菜单中的所有预选选项.
以下是菜单示例:
<select name="ddBusinessCategory" id="ddBusinessCategory" class="f1" style="width:280px;height:200px" multiple="multiple">
<option value="">Select One</option>
<optgroup label="Abrasives" style="background:#F5F5F5;border-bottom:1px #EEE solid">
<option value="4" selected="selected">Abrasives</option>
</optgroup>
<optgroup label="Abstracters" style="background:#F5F5F5;border-bottom:1px #EEE solid">
<option value="5">Abstracters</option>
</optgroup>
<optgroup label="Abuse Information & Treatment Centers" style="background:#F5F5F5;border-bottom:1px #EEE solid">
<option value="6" selected="selected">Abuse Information & Treatment Centers</option>
</optgroup>
<optgroup label="Accountants" style="background:#F5F5F5;border-bottom:1px #EEE solid">
<option value="7">Accountants</option>
<option value="2672">Certified Public Accountants - </option>
<option value="2673">Public Accountants - </option>
</optgroup>
<optgroup label="Accounting Services" style="background:#F5F5F5;border-bottom:1px #EEE solid">
<option value="8">Accounting Services</option>
</optgroup>
<optgroup label="Acoustical Materials - Wholesale & …Run Code Online (Sandbox Code Playgroud) 是否可以在您的网页上创建一个可以在同一页面上播放嵌入式YouTube视频的超链接.
我们刚刚转移到具有Windows 2008和SQL Server 2008的新专用服务器.我正在尝试使用同一服务器访问ASP页面Server.CreateObject("MSXML2.ServerXMLHTTP").
在我们之前的2003服务器上,这工作正常,但是对于新的2008服务器,操作只是超时.
这是代码:
strURL = "http://www.storeboard.com/profile/profile_view.asp?MemberID=" & MemberID & "&sid=" & cSession.SessionID
Set oXMLHttp = Server.CreateObject("MSXML2.ServerXMLHTTP")
oXMLHttp.open "GET", strURL, false
oXMLHttp.send()
IF oXMLHttp.status = 200 THEN
strOut = oXMLHttp.responseText
ELSE
strOut = "Could not get XML data."
END IF
Set oXMLHttp = nothing
Run Code Online (Sandbox Code Playgroud)
代码很简单,但是我收到以下错误:
msxml3.dll error '80072ee2'
The operation timed out
/handle404.asp, line 291
Run Code Online (Sandbox Code Playgroud)
第291行引用oXMLHttp.Send()行.
我可以使用替代代码吗?我在服务器上的其他位置使用脚本访问其他服务器上的文件并且它们正常工作,但是对我们服务器上的文件的任何访问都不起作用.
是否有一种替代方法可以让我在浏览器中保持URL完好无损?此人可以在他们的浏览器中写入URL:http://www.example.com/hello该文件不存在,但我有一个404处理程序,然后将用户指向正确的路径,而不更改浏览器URL,这是必不可少的对于我们的SEO评级.
我需要一些帮助.我必须创建一个包含更多javascript的javascript字符串,然后将其写入父窗口中的div标签.代码如下:
<script language="javascript" type="text/javascript">
var jstr2 = '';
jstr2 += '<script language="javascript">\n';
jstr2 += 'function doPagingProducts(str) {\n';
jstr2 += 'document.frmPagingProducts.PG.value = str\;\n';
jstr2 += 'document.frmPagingProducts.submit()\;\n';
jstr2 += 'return false\;\n';
jstr2 += '}\n';
jstr2 += '</script>\n';
jstr2 += '\n';
</script>
Run Code Online (Sandbox Code Playgroud)
但是,创建的字符串中的结束脚本标记实际上关闭了javascript,我得到的错误如下:
Error: unterminated string literal
Line: 135, Column: 9 ( The </script> line before the end of the string.)
Source Code:
jstr2 += '
Run Code Online (Sandbox Code Playgroud)
有什么办法可以防止这个问题..?
非常感谢你的帮助.
最诚挚的问候,保罗
编辑 我终于通过</script>从javascript字符串中提取final 来解决这个问题.我添加了脚本显示的结束标记.它凌乱,但它的工作原理.非常感谢您的所有评论.
我的页面上有每个都包含唯一内容的标签.我想在不点击它们的情况下自动旋转标签和内容.页面加载后,我希望此功能开始使用window.onload = function().
我有以下JavaScript数组:
var HomeTabs = [1, 3, 5, 7, 9, 11]
Run Code Online (Sandbox Code Playgroud)
我想知道如何显示HomeTab 1 10秒然后移动到HomeTab 3然后10秒后按顺序移动到HomeTab 5,而不是随机.当它到达HomeTab 11时,它会再次回到HomeTab 1.
我有一个脚本来更改选项卡ChangeTab(1),其中一个是我想要显示的选项卡的编号.
我有以下字符串:
[27564][85938][457438][273][48232]
Run Code Online (Sandbox Code Playgroud)
我想替换所有[与''.我尝试了以下但它不起作用:
var str = '[27564][85938][457438][273][48232]'
var nChar = '[';
var re = new RegExp(nChar, 'g')
var visList = str.replace(re,'');
Run Code Online (Sandbox Code Playgroud)
我在这做错了什么?
提前谢谢了.
我如何获得本周的周一日期.星期一是一周的第一天.因此,如果我本周查阅它将返回2012年1月16日的日期
我正在使用VBScript和ASP
提前谢谢了..
保罗
这可能是一个简单的,但我无法理解它.
我有一个MemberBusinessCats表,其中包含一个BusinessCatID和一个MemberID ..表可以这样呈现:
+-----------------------+-----------------+------------+
| MemberBusinessCatID | BusinessCatID | MemberID |
+-----------------------+-----------------+------------+
| 27 | 45 | 102 |
+-----------------------+-----------------+------------+
| 28 | 55 | 102 |
+-----------------------+-----------------+------------+
| 29 | 61 | 102 |
+-----------------------+-----------------+------------+
| 30 | 45 | 33 |
+-----------------------+-----------------+------------+
| 31 | 23 | 33 |
+-----------------------+-----------------+------------+
| 32 | 45 | 73 |
+-----------------------+-----------------+------------+
| 32 | 61 | 73 |
+-----------------------+-----------------+------------+
| 32 | 45 | 73 |
+-----------------------+-----------------+------------+
Run Code Online (Sandbox Code Playgroud)
如何制作脚本以显示以下数据
+-----------------+---------------------+
| BusinessCatID …Run Code Online (Sandbox Code Playgroud) 出于某种原因,下面的代码返回结果,但输入顺序不正确.
任何人都有任何想法,因为我已经看了几个小时,但还没有发现问题:
USE [storeboard]
GO
/****** Object: StoredProcedure [sbuser].[sp_MemberMailList ] Script Date: 11/25/2011 12:04:15 ******/
SET ANSI_NULLS ON
GO
SET QUOTED_IDENTIFIER ON
GO
ALTER PROC [sbuser].[sp_MemberMailList ]
@MemberMailID bigint = null,
@FromMemberID bigint = null,
@ToMemberID bigint = null,
@Subject varchar(150) = null,
@Message varchar(8000) = null,
@FromDeletedFlag bit = null,
@ToDeletedFlag bit = null,
@FromArchivedFlag bit = null,
@ToArchivedFlag bit = null,
@ReadFlag bit = null,
@SQL nvarchar(4000) = null,
@SortField varchar(100) = null,
@SortOrder varchar(25) = null,
@NotificationSent …Run Code Online (Sandbox Code Playgroud) 我有一个房子数据库.在房屋内,mssql数据库记录是一个名为areaID的字段.房子可以在多个区域,因此数据库中的条目可以如下:
+---------+----------------------+-----------+-------------+-------+
| HouseID | AreaID | HouseType | Description | Title |
+---------+----------------------+-----------+-------------+-------+
| 21 | 17, 32, 53 | B | data | data |
+---------+----------------------+-----------+-------------+-------+
| 23 | 23, 73 | B | data | data |
+---------+----------------------+-----------+-------------+-------+
| 24 | 53, 12, 153, 72, 153 | B | data | data |
+---------+----------------------+-----------+-------------+-------+
| 23 | 23, 53 | B | data | data |
+---------+----------------------+-----------+-------------+-------+
Run Code Online (Sandbox Code Playgroud)
如果我打开一个仅在区域53中呼叫房屋的页面,我将如何搜索它.我知道在MySQL中你可以使用find_in_SET但我使用的是Microsoft SQL Server 2005.
我正在尝试使用javascript中的数组.请考虑以下代码:
var visList = '1234,5678,9'
var visListArray = new Array(visList);
for (i = 0; i <= visListArray.length - 1; i++)
{
alert(visListArray[i]);
}
Run Code Online (Sandbox Code Playgroud)
为什么不将数组分成单个数字而不是所有数组聚集在一起?
任何帮助将非常感激.
非常感谢
是否有可能使用IF-ELSE或类似的东西做这样的事情:
SELECT
MemberID,
ProfileTypeID
PrCountryID, -- 3
PrStateID, -- 4
PrStateInt
FROM Member
WHERE PrCity IS NOT NULL
IF @ShowUnclaimed = 'N'
AND Claimed = 'Y'
AND SBIcon = 'N'
END
AND Viewable = 'Y'
AND SystemID = 2
Run Code Online (Sandbox Code Playgroud)
非常感谢任何信息.
neojakey
javascript ×6
sql ×4
sql-server ×3
t-sql ×3
asp-classic ×2
html ×1
vbscript ×1
video ×1
youtube ×1
youtube-api ×1